In 2023 it handled 343 million tonnes of cargo, up 9.4 percent year on year, with annual container throughput above 2 million TEU. Some 4,166 metres of Yangtze frontage and 88 berths — 14 of them for vessels over 10,000 DWT — connect the port to 312 harbours in 96 countries.
